03 Jan 2017 | 05:08 UTC — Houston
Following industry consultation, S&P Global Platts has discontinued the daily spark spread table that publishes in Coal Trader, effective January 3, 2017.
Platts believes the spark spread's design was no longer relevant to the market. Platts is considering possible replacements, but is still studying several scenarios.
The relevant codes are as follows:
CTSS100, CTSS200, CTSS300, CTSS400, CTSS500, CTSS600; CTST100, CTST200, CTST300, CTST400, CTST500, CTST600; CTSU001, CTSU002, CTSU003, CTSU004, CTSU005, CTSU006, CTSU007, CTSU008, CTSU009; CTSU010, CTSU011, CTSU012, CTSU013, CTSU014, CTSU015, CTSU016, CTSU017, CTSU018.
